CARE OF UNIVERSAL BEVEL PROTRACTORS


A protractor Is a precision Instrument. If you follow the steps below, the accuracy of your
protractor will be maintained. '

1. Always wipe the Instrument with a soft, lint-free cloth before using It. This will prevent rust
and grit from being ground Into the working parts of the protractor. . ,
